Now!, Vol. 6 features such inescapable 2001 radio and video hits as Lifehouse's "Hanging by a Moment," Nelly Furtado's "I'm Like a Bird," and "Yellow" from Coldplay. But, since this is a Canadian installment of the series, there's also stuff from the Moffatts, Smoother, and SoulDecision. Johnny Loftus, All Music Guide

Daft Punk finally makes an appearance on the second compilation by the French label, contributing the incredible B-side "Musique." As well, Dimitri from Paris, Alex Gopher, Air, Zend Avesta and Le Tone make appearances. Keith Farley, All Music Guide
